The Role

CAE Engineer will be responsible for capturing information from a variety of sources inside and outside GM building and running analytical models interpreting results for customers attending development team meetings interacting with compartment integration teams.

A CAE Analysis Engineer in the Battery Structures Thermal Electrical & High Voltage System team performs battery module and pack system level FEA structural analysis for high voltage battery module pack and vehicle integration. You will work closely with vehicle CAE team to consider integration of battery into vehicle structure provide results and technical consultation to battery and vehicle engineers and deliver design solutions which are robust and reliable utilizing optimization and statistical methods.

What Youll Do

  • Perform Cell module and packlevel structure analysis for early design and verification of battery concepts components and support systems including their vehicle integration.
  • Provide vibration stiffness stress fatigue durability and crash/safety results with minimal mass penalty and optimal manufacturing.

  • Develop battery concepts for early vehicle synthesis and improve production designs.

  • Provide requirements for improvements to advanced simulation and validation techniques.

  • Conduct shape and size topology optimization.

  • Develop and Conduct Manufacturing and assembly operation simulation from Cell to Module to Pack.

  • Develop and coordinate battery structural verification activities.

  • Prepare CAD and material data as needed for FEA model creation.

  • Effectively communicate findings to internal/external customers using appropriate media.

  • Meet or exceed deadlines for structured product development timelines quality and cost.

  • Collaborate with broader engineering team for structured design integration new proposals problem solving and system optimization.

  • Provide requirements for improvements to advanced simulation activities

  • Participate in benchmarking activities.

Additional Job Description

Your Skills & Abilities (Required Qualifications)

  • BS in Mechanical Aerospace or Civil Engineering required
  • 5 years of experience with model creation and FEA analysis
  • Knowledge in structural engineering materials largescale nonlinear problems optimization topology reliability robust design and process automation
  • High level of oral and written communication skills

What Will Give You A Competitive Edge (Preferred Qualifications)

  • Experience in using ABAQUS (Implicit Explicit ABAQUS CAE) ANSYS Workbench ANSA Hypermesh iSIGHT NASTRAN Optistruct GENESIS.
  • MS in Mechanical or Aerospace Engineering preferred
  • Experience in using UG NX
  • Direct experience applying FEA tools to battery or propulsionrelated systems
